About Ashish Kawale
Ashish obtained his PhD degree in Structural Biology at Technical University of Munich, Germany in 2017. During PhD, he studied structure-function relationships of D. melanogaster mRNA splicing factors and their interactions with target mRNAs using an advanced biomolecular NMR spectroscopy.
In Burmann group, he is deciphering the structural and dynamical aspects of UvrD helicase crucial for mediating transcription-coupled DNA repair pathway in bacteria.
